Japan Bromine Market Overview

Market Size & Growth :

Japan's bromine market is valued at USD 194.4 million in 2025 and is projected to reach USD 269.0 million by 2030, growing at a CAGR of 6.7%, outpacing the global growth rate of 5.6%.

Flame Retardant Dominance :

Brominated flame retardants drive Japan's market due to stringent fire safety regulations in electronics, automotive, and construction sectors, where compliance with JIS and other Japanese standards is mandatory.

Electronics & Automotive Demand :

Japan's advanced electronics manufacturing and automotive industries are primary consumers of bromine compounds, particularly for circuit boards, wiring harnesses, and interior components requiring fire-resistant properties.

Regulatory Environment :

Japan's strict environmental and safety regulations, including RoHS and REACH compliance requirements, shape bromine product specifications and drive innovation in safer brominated formulations.

        Primary Research

        The bromine market comprises several stakeholders in the supply chain, including manufacturers, suppliers, traders, associations, and regulatory organizations. On the demand side, the market includes flame retardant manufacturers, oil & gas service companies using clear brine fluids, pharmaceutical and agrochemical producers, water treatment solution providers, semiconductor manufacturers utilizing high-purity hydrogen bromide for plasma etching, polymer and rubber manufacturers producing brominated butyl rubber, and textile and electronics manufacturers incorporating brominated compounds to enhance material performance and safety characteristics. Demand is further supported by automotive component producers, construction material manufacturers, and industrial processors that rely on bromine-based formulations for functional properties such as flame resistance, biocidal activity, and chemical reactivity in synthesis processes. On the supply side, the market consists primarily of companies engaged in the extraction of bromine from natural brine reservoirs and saline resources, followed by integrated chemical manufacturers that convert elemental bromine into derivatives such as organobromines, clear brine fluids, and hydrogen bromide. Specialty chemical producers formulate application-specific brominated compounds tailored for industrial and high-purity requirements. In addition, distributors, trading companies, and logistics providers facilitate storage, transportation, and regional market access, particularly in areas without local production facilities. Regulatory agencies and environmental authorities also play a role in shaping supply practices through compliance standards and chemical usage guidelines, influencing both production processes and product specifications within the bromine market ecosystem.         Market Definition

        Bromine is a naturally occurring halogen element primarily extracted from bromide-rich brine reservoirs and saline water sources, where it exists in dissolved salt form before being processed into commercially valuable derivatives. As a highly reactive reddish-brown liquid at room temperature, bromine serves as an essential chemical intermediate across a wide range of industrial applications. It is converted into key derivatives, such as organobromines, clear brine fluids, and hydrogen bromide, each of which supports distinct end uses. These derivatives collectively serve diverse application areas, including flame retardants, water treatment & biocides, mercury emission control, oil & gas drilling, PTA synthesis, flow batteries, pesticides, plasma etching, pharmaceuticals, and butyl rubber production. Consequently, bromine demand is closely linked to end-user industries such as oil & gas, electrical & electronics, automotive, agriculture, pharmaceuticals, textiles, cosmetics, and other industrial sectors, reflecting its broad industrial integration and strategic importance in global manufacturing value chains.
